Hi I’m hoping someone will be able to answer my question. If the bank I had a loan with charged off the debt, ie sold it to a debt collection company, would this show up on my credit file? Would it still show as a current loan?
I’m asking this question because I’m confused. I had a loan with TSB but lost my job due to illness, and long story short, they agreed to suspend payments until I was back at work. I recently checked the balance online and it shows a 0 balance, with c.off next to it. I checked my credit report yesterday and there is no mention of me owing this money, no mention of the loan even though there was still over £23,000 left to pay back. This charge is dated 28th November so why isn’t it showing up on the report?
My report is only showing for 1 month, I don’t know how to get one further back than that.
Thanks in advance
